Weekly Compilation of Presidential Documents:
About the Weekly Comp.

Cover Weekly Compilation of Presidential Documents.The Weekly Compilation is issued every Monday and contains statements, messages, and other Presidential material released by the White House during the preceding week. It includes such material as:

  • proclamations
  • executive orders
  • speeches
  • press conferences
  • communications to Congress and Federal agencies
  • statements regarding bill signings and vetoes
  • appointments, nominations
  • reorganization plans
  • resignations
  • retirements
  • acts approved by the President
  • nominations submitted to the Senate
  • White House announcements
  • press releases

Published by the Office of the Federal Register, National Archives and Records Administration (NARA), the Weekly Compilation of Presidential Documents first began in 1965.

The Weekly Compilation of Presidential Documents has been replaced by the Daily Compilation of Presidential Documents as of January 29, 2009. The Weekly Compilation of Presidential Documents application on GPO Access is provided as an archive of the content as it was as of the last edition. Documents are available as ASCII text and Adobe Portable Document Format (PDF) files. From 1977 onward, all material appearing in the Weekly Compilation of Presidential Documents is incorporated into the Public Papers of the Presidents of the United States.

OFR editors prepare subject, name, and document category indexes to this material, and issue these quarterly, semiannually, and annually under a separate cover.
